Reminiscing about the past, so many exciting years, hehe, let’s first talk about the pros and cons of running in 2013. First, we put safety first.

It includes both personal safety and running safety. Safety is the foundation of life and is the first step in everything. 1. No matter whether running or competing in 2013, there was no damage to joints or muscles. All indicators of the annual physical examination were qualified or excellent, and the cardiopulmonary function was good.

, indicating that there are no hidden diseases caused by running. Very good! Very good! Great!!! Haha.

Second, I ran 1,882 kilometers in one year. As a long-distance marathon runner, this amount is a bit pitiful. The number of attendances has not been counted. It is estimated that it will not exceed 180 days, which should be less than half. As a long-distance running enthusiast, the attendance is too low.

Reasons: 1. I am quite busy. I renovated two apartments this year, which inevitably took up a lot of time.

2. There is a lot of smog and haze. People in Shijiazhuang have to look at the sky at a 45-degree angle, otherwise they will burst into tears.

3. Sometimes I’m a bit lazy. There are still some days when the left brain says forget it, don’t run away today, and the right brain says the left brain is right.

4. There are too many races, which leads to a lot of rest after the race. In the week after a marathon or ultra-marathon, rest is usually the main thing.

3. There were 15 marathons, including 3 half-marathons and 12 full marathons, all of which were successfully completed.

The goal set for this year last year was to participate in as many competitions as possible on the basis of competition safety. This year, we have basically completed the planned plan. However, some results are a bit too trendy, such as East Malaysia 529, but there are also some that are beyond expectations.

Unexpected performance, such as 337 in the North Marathon, a personal best, which was an unexpected surprise. In addition, I also ran several marathons with the flag of the runner or running bar. It was amazing.

Four, three ultramarathons.

Mentougou drank a bottle of soy sauce without any pursuit; Yishan did not regret giving up after 60 kilometers. The main reason was that it was raining behind and it was too dark after 22 o'clock in the evening to find the road signs. In addition, the most important thing was that there was a hill and a half behind that looked very strange.

There were steep mountain peaks, so I gave up. I finished the 100 kilometers in Ishino in 28 and a half hours with great difficulty. I was so exhausted and exhausted that I will never forget it. I finished the race in last place, and I deserved it.

Five, mountaineering and cross-country.

There was a lot of mountaineering and cross-country climbing in the first half of this year, which is commendable. But compared with strong people, there is still a big difference. For example, the Northeast Big Fatty, our best marathon results are not too different. I am a little better, but my mountaineering level is too different.

Sixth, swimming and cycling strength training. They all involve a little bit, but they are all lackluster. They are better than nothing.

7. Work, rest and diet. Let’s count it as a bright spot. It has been developing in a good direction. Most of the time, the work and rest are very regular. Go to bed at 9-10 pm and get up at 5-5:30 am for a run.

Eat less and less, stay away from junk food gradually, and practice well.
